Arable Land
Arable landWoodlands Farm land has been farmed in atraditional cereal rotation of winter wheat, springbarley, and oil seed rape. The land is well drainedand potentially suitable for root crops.Field numbers0226: 0.65 acre0226: 2.85 acres8911: 9.27 acres9939: 7.98 acres8329; 8.79 acres

Steel Framed Barn
Steel framed agricultural barnMain barn external area is:20' (6.1m) x 30' (9.2m) = 56 sq.m (605 sq.ft)Lean to:13'1" (4m) x 28'2" (8.6m) = 35 sq.m (377 sq.ft)Description of barnThe steel framed barn has a concrete floor withconcrete block walls and metal sheeted wallcovering and a profile sheeted roof.The internal area of the ground floor of the proposeddwelling is: 18'7" sq.ft (5.7m) x 29'1" (8.9m) 51 sq.m(550 sq.ft) and the net internal area of the two storeydwelling: 1,100 sq.ft (102 sq.m).Planning Application Link:

The Park Home
The Park home sits on a concrete base adjacentto the steel framed barn and has consent tobe used by the owners in conjunction with thefarming operation.Concrete base:28'2" (8.6m) x 36' (11m)

The Bungalow
DescriptionA detached bungalow Woodlands was built in the1960's with a private drive in an elevated settingcommanding views across "The Grey Valley"with the back drop of the Black Mountains. Theproperty is surrounded by farmland and forestry inunspoilt countryside. The bungalow is constructedof brick, stone and concrete blocks under a tiledroof with timber framed windows and could beimproved and modernized.Agricultural occupancy restrictionThe bungalow is subject to an agriculturaloccupancy restriction which restricts theoccupation of the property to someone employed(or last employed) in agriculture or forestry

Services
ServicesMains electricity and mains water are connectedto the bungalow property. The bungalow is heatedwith an oil fired central heating boiler, and the oilis stored in a bunded oil tank. There is a privatedrainage system with soak aways within one of thecorners of a field 0226
